The Philadelphia Eagles and the San Francisco 49ers have agreed on a trade that sends pass rusher Bryce Huff out west in exchange for a conditional 2026 fifth-round pick that could turn into a fourth-round pick based on Huff's performance, per CBS Sports NFL insider Jonathan Jones . The deal is pending a physical.

Reports of a potential trade surfaced on May 30, though the deal could not be processed until after June 1. Both sides had been working to make the deal happen, with Huff reworking his contract to help facilitate it.
